Leading Nigerian prelate decries tribal violence

October 24, 2017

» Continue to this story on Fides

CWN Editor's Note: The “peaceful, harmonious, and fraternal coexistence” between the Fulani and the Irigwe “has been severely wounded,” the president of the Nigerian bishops’ conference said following the brutal murder of at least 29 civilians.
